An aircraft charter broking and wet lease organisation has been set up in the UK by Australian company Strategic Airlines.
The company’s fleet includes two Airbus A320-200s, one of which is to be based in Europe, and an A330-200.
The European-based A320 operating under a French air operators certificate is being marketed in Europe by Neill Huston, who joins Strategic Airlines as UK commercial director at its newly-estblished Gatwick office.
